The Impact of Habitat Loss on Animal Populations
Habitat loss serves as a significant threat to animal populations globally, compromising biodiversity and ecosystem stability. Urban development, deforestation, and agricultural expansion lead to the degradation of natural habitats. This process critically influences various species, causing population declines and potential extinction. When animals lose their homes, they often struggle to survive, resulting in reduced breeding success and increased mortality rates. The fragmentation of habitats isolates animal groups, making it challenging for them to find mates. Consequently, genetic diversity diminishes, further jeopardizing their long-term survival. Additionally, as natural habitats vanish, remaining ecosystems may become inhospitable due to overpopulation and increased competition for resources. Such changes can lead to only a limited number of species adapting to new environments, detracting from overall biodiversity. The depletion of habitat also heightens human-wildlife conflict, as animals venture into urban areas in search of food and shelter. Consequences of Habitat Fragmentation
Habitat fragmentation emerges as a pressing issue arising from habitat loss, causing adverse effects on animal populations and ecosystems. When large habitats are divided into smaller patches, many species find it difficult to migrate, reproduce, and gather resources. As a result, the small remaining areas can no longer support viable populations. For example, fragmented landscapes can disrupt migration routes for birds and mammals, depriving them of safe travel paths to critical resources, such as food and breeding grounds. In some cases, isolated populations become genetically vulnerable, increasing susceptibility to diseases and environmental changes. Anticipating and understanding these effects is essential for effective conservation strategies. Restoration projects must incorporate connectivity measures, such as wildlife corridors and overpasses, to facilitate animal movement across fragmented landscapes. By enhancing landscape permeability, we can mitigate some detrimental effects of fragmentation, promoting genetic diversity. Successful Restoration Case Studies
Examining successful habitat restoration case studies illustrates the positive impacts such initiatives have on animal populations. For instance, efforts to restore wetlands in specific regions have resulted in the revival of numerous aquatic and avian species, supporting thriving ecosystems. In areas like the Everglades, comprehensive restoration projects focus on water management and invasive species control, bringing back native wildlife. Another inspiring example is the reforestation of deforested areas, leading to increased biodiversity and the return of endemic species. Conservationists have successfully implemented rewilding projects in various regions, restoring landscapes to their natural conditions, enabling animal migration and ecosystem recovery. In Europe, initiatives have led to the recovery of populations of wolves and bison, showcasing the resilience of nature when given a chance. Important Steps in Habitat Restoration
Successful habitat restoration involves several crucial steps that ensure effectiveness and long-term viability of ecosystems. First and foremost, assessing the condition of the current habitat and identifying stressors is essential. This helps define the goals of the restoration project, targeting the specific needs of the landscape. Next, developing a comprehensive plan outlining restoration strategies is vital, which involves selecting native plant species for replanting and considering the natural topography. Habitat connectivity should also be included, ensuring movement corridors for wildlife. Monitoring and evaluating the process regularly highlights the need for adjustments, ensuring the restoration project adapts to changing conditions.
